church planting vision The vision for the Great Lakes Region is to raise up, train, and release planters and teams for 75 churches by 2013. Our goals to fulfill this vision: - Work with local churches to help them identify and train their potential planters.
- Sponsor conferences and events designed to cast vision for church planting as a worthy Kingdom calling.
- Develop and implement Church Planter (and team) Boot Camps to train planters in core competencies.
- Conduct timely and authentic assessments of potential planters.
- Nurture a healthy coaching network.

criteria for planting Potential Church Plant Criteria Prior to First Year Pastor's Recommendation turned in Application completed and turned in to closest church plant coordinator Assessment completed with team from the district or region Acceptance into the program by the CPC and APC. Coach is assigned who will oversee the training and development of the plant through the subsequent stages. |

insurance Many of you carry liability insurance, but for those of you who don't, we suggest a policy that includes riders to cover sexual abuse and other emotional traumas. By all means, shop around and choose whatever company best suits your needs. If you need a place to start, a number of Vineyard churches in the region use Brotherhood Mutual. If you'd like more information, please contact the regional office. |
